Protecting Kids Hearing – Methods of Headphone Volume Control

Using headphones with electronic electronic equipment (MP3’s, iPads/iPods, CD’s, computers, electronic readers, e.g.) is often necessary in inclusionary settings when students are working on parallel curriculum tasks in the classroom. TouchFire Screen-Top Keyboard

A comment to the post about “sturdy cases” from Ann Sciabarrasi, OTR shared the TouchFire Screen-Top Keyboard, a new iPad keyboard. Created by two tech developers, Steve Isaac and Bradley Melmon, this keyboard is small and portable attaching to the iPad with corner magnets.
